Georgetown Energy Museum, located at 600 Griffith St, Georgetown, CO 80444, United States, is a unique museum and tourist attraction that offers a glimpse into the history and physics of energy production. The museum is housed in a still-working power plant, providing a fascinating and educational experience for visitors of all ages.
Specialties
The museum specializes in preserving and showcasing the history of energy production, with a focus on the Georgetown Energy Company's hydroelectric plant. Visitors can learn about the physics of energy conversion, the evolution of power generation technology, and the impact of energy production on local communities.
